Scoring Summary
| Time | Team | Goal | Assists | Strength | Score (Minnesota Wild–Boston Bruins) |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1st 01:01 | BOS | Andrew Peeke | David Pastrnak, Fraser Minten | 5v5 | 0–1 |
| 1st 14:00 | BOS | Pavel Zacha | Viktor Arvidsson, Casey Mittelstadt | 5v5 | 0–2 |
| 2nd 10:27 | BOS | Viktor Arvidsson | David Pastrnak, Hampus Lindholm | 5v5 | 0–3 |
| 2nd 14:46 | MIN | Kirill Kaprizov | Ryan Hartman, Brock Faber | 5v5 | 1–3 |
| 3rd 03:48 | BOS | Elias Lindholm | Lukas Reichel, Hampus Lindholm | 5v5 | 1–4 |
| 3rd 07:57 | MIN | Mats Zuccarello | Quinn Hughes | 3v5 | 2–4 |
| 3rd 13:44 | MIN | Ryan Hartman | Quinn Hughes, Mats Zuccarello | 5v5 | 3–4 |
| 3rd 16:50 | BOS | Pavel Zacha | Casey Mittelstadt | 5v5 | 3–5 |
| 3rd 19:26 | BOS | Elias Lindholm | Casey Mittelstadt | 5v6 | 3–6 |

Analysis
The Boston Bruins defeated the Minnesota Wild 6–3 on Mar 28, 2026.
Boston Bruins generated 3.6 expected goals to Minnesota Wild's 4.1 — Minnesota Wild owned the better of the chances but Boston Bruins took the game, the kind of split that usually means finishing or goaltending decided it; by expected goals it was close to a coin flip.
Casey Mittelstadt led all skaters with a Game Score of 2.89 on 3 assists, 1 shots on goal.
Jeremy Swayman stopped 31 of 34, worth 0.69 goals saved above expected.
